Overview
Crawling Valley Reservoir (commonly called Barkenhouse Lake) is a reservoir in southern Alberta's Crawling Valley, located north of the town of Vulcan. The lake is open May 8 to Nov 30 between sunrise and sunset and open all day Dec 1 to Mar 15; bait is allowed ("Bait except bait fish allowed"). Species limits: walleye 0 or SHL tags; northern pike 1 fish 63–70 cm; yellow perch 15 fish; burbot 10 fish; lake whitefish 10 fish.
